Mechanical Drafters salary by percentile in Michigan
BLS-reported salary distribution — from entry-level (10th percentile) to top earners (90th percentile).
Mechanical Drafters in Michigan earn a median salary of $72,280 per year ($6,023/month).
This is 5.2% above the national average of $68,696.
Michigan ranks #17 out of 47 states for Mechanical Drafters pay.
Approximately 2,030 people work in this occupation across Michigan.
Salaries decreased by 2.8% compared to 2024.
About This Job: Mechanical Drafters
Prepare detailed working diagrams of machinery and mechanical devices, including dimensions, fastening methods, and other engineering information.

Salaries for Mechanical Drafters in Michigan range from $47,100 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$112,170 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$57,720 and $94,900.

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2025 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.
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
